Output d2670878e2882b3b047481d4f853a9253d19a1a6cf81c2e52d9b6914f5b261b2:1

value
85752
script pubkey
OP_0 OP_PUSHBYTES_20 d43703eb6d48f1644b08148f696c1929409def80
address
bc1q6sms86mdfrckgjcgzj8kjmqe99qfmmuqathycv
transaction
d2670878e2882b3b047481d4f853a9253d19a1a6cf81c2e52d9b6914f5b261b2
confirmations
215966
spent
true